West Northamptonshire Council is a new large unitary council serving nearly half a million people, in settlements ranging from the historic town of Northampton (230,000) to the smallest hamlets, across 1,400km2 of attractive countryside. We have an ambitious transformation programme, providing services and assets to meet the needs of our communities in sustainable ways.   

We need a talented and ambitious individual who can lead the Council’s building construction activity, delivering a wide range of projects safely, sustainable, and efficiently. The pipeline of projects is large and wide ranging including new schools, relocatable temporary accommodation, provision of children’s homes, office optimisation, renewable energy, leisure facilities, and more. Current projects range from around £100k up to £25 million in value. Additionally, you would be providing technical support to wider corporate responsibilities and projects, such as one of the largest school PFIs, economic development, and the built environment. 

We are seeking a construction professional who is a good leader and manager, someone who has experience of managing multiple projects that range in their value and complexity, with a keen eye for detail, understanding of commercial issues, and most importantly someone that can help enable service transformation across the Council and within the team. Ideally you will also be someone who can bring expertise in quality design to the team as we seek to build up our in-house technical expertise. 

The new Manager will be a key part of the management of Works service and Assets & Environment team, within the Place, Economy & Environment Directorate. You will work across the Council and with partners to secure the optimal outcomes for our people. You should expect to be well known to senior Members and Directors, and key external partners.

What will you be doing?To be the Council’s professional lead for building construction. Leading, developing, and managing a multi-disciplinary design and construction delivery team on varied projects across a range of sectors within agreed project time, cost, quality, and safety, enabling services to efficiently meet their obligations. Championing good design across the Council’s build programme.

Be responsible for the successful delivery of key strategic Council priority programmes and projects. Develop, plan, implement and review strategies, processes and policies that enable delivery of corporate objectives. Robustly manage project and programme performance, reporting to Members, the Executive Leadership Team (ELT) and external partners such as the Department for Education (DfE). Identify programme delivery risks and implement mitigations to ensure successful delivery.
